你有没有想过,那些让你沉迷其中的网页游戏,背后其实有着一个超级强大的“大脑”——那就是网页游戏后台!今天,就让我带你一起揭开这个神秘的面纱,看看这个“大脑”是如何运作的,又是如何让游戏世界运转自如的。
一、网关:游戏世界的守门人

想象网页游戏就像是一座热闹的城堡,而网关就是这座城堡的守门人。所有玩家进入游戏,都必须通过这个守门人,它负责隔离游戏逻辑服务器和玩家,保护游戏服务器内部不受攻击。
网关的作用可不止于此,它还像一位聪明的调度员,将玩家发送的消息路由到地图服务器上处理。比如,你在游戏中移动,网关就会将你的移动信息转发到对应的地图服务器,服务器处理完毕后再将结果传回网关,最后由网关转发给其他玩家。
不过,网关也有它的烦恼。在网络游戏中,单个客户端上行流量很小,但下行广播数据却非常庞大。曾经测试过,300人同屏在线时,每秒钟会有300万条位置更新消息,这可是一个不小的挑战啊!
二、地图服务器:游戏世界的舞台

地图服务器就像是游戏世界的舞台,负责处理玩家的具体操作。每个地图服务器通常对应一个游戏服,玩家在游戏中的各种动作,如战斗、行走等,都会在这里得到处理。
地图服务器的工作量很大,因为它需要处理大量的玩家数据。不过,聪明的开发者们想出了很多办法来提高效率,比如使用epoll的边缘出发模式(非阻塞)和多线程收发消息,确保游戏流畅运行。
三、后台运营:游戏世界的管家

网页游戏后台不仅仅是一个技术系统,它还是游戏世界的管家。后台运营团队负责游戏的日常运营、数据监控、玩家管理、活动配置等工作。
1. 用户管理:后台需要处理用户注册、登录、账号安全、用户资料管理、角色信息、付费记录等。强大的查询和统计功能可以帮助运营团队快速定位和解决问题。
2. 游戏数据监控:通过对游戏内各种数据的实时监控,运营团队可以了解游戏的健康状况,调整游戏策略,优化用户体验,预防作弊行为。
3. 活动配置:后台需要具备灵活的活动配置功能,能够快速设置新活动,如限时任务、登录奖励、充值活动等。
4. 资源管理:游戏内的资源管理涉及道具、装备、货币等。后台需要有完善的资源生成、消耗、回收机制,确保游戏经济系统的平衡。
5. 客户服务:后台通常包含客服系统,用于处理玩家的咨询、投诉和建议。
6. 数据分析与报表:后台需提供丰富的数据分析工具,生成各类报表,如玩家行为分析等。
四、网页游戏平台:游戏世界的枢纽
网页游戏平台是游戏世界的枢纽,它连接着玩家、游戏开发者、运营团队等各方。一个优秀的网页游戏平台应该具备以下功能:
1. 用户中心:提供用户注册、登录、密码设置等功能。
2. 注册登录:方便玩家快速注册和登录游戏。
3. 充值中心:提供便捷的充值方式,让玩家轻松购买游戏道具。
4. 游戏中心:展示各种游戏,方便玩家选择喜欢的游戏。
5. 新闻公告:发布游戏最新动态,让玩家及时了解游戏信息。
6. 开服表:展示游戏开服时间,方便玩家选择合适的游戏时间。
7. 平台币:提供平台币购买、兑换等功能。
8. 游戏官网:提供游戏详细介绍,让玩家了解游戏背景、玩法等。
9. 游戏盒子微端:提供游戏微端下载,方便玩家快速进入游戏。
后台运营、游戏数据监控、活动配置、资源管理、客户服务、数据分析与报表等功能,都需要在后台系统中得到体现。一个优秀的网页游戏平台,应该为玩家提供便捷、高效、安全的游戏体验。
现在,你对网页游戏后台有了更深入的了解了吗?这个神秘的“大脑”不仅让游戏世界运转自如,还让玩家们能够享受到丰富多彩的游戏体验。让我们一起期待,未来网页游戏后台会带给我们更多惊喜吧!
网友评论